Layer reconstruction, collapse and metallization of van der Waals bonded ZrS2 under high pressure

Qingyang Hu,
Linfei Yang,
Junwei Li
et al.

Abstract: In contrast to two-dimensional (2D) monolayer materials, van der Waals layered transition metal dichalcogenides exhibit rich polymorphism, making them promising candidates for novel superconductors, topological insulators, and high-performance electrochemical catalysts.
